For decades, rumors have swirled that Stevie Wonder, one of the most influential musicians of our time, isn’t really blind—that he’s just been pretending. But at a recent performance in Wales, the 75-year-old artist addressed the bizarre conspiracy theory directly and, with warmth and grace, finally put it to rest.
“I have to tell you something,” Wonder told the audience during a moment of honesty from the stage. “There have been rumors that I can see and all that,” he said, prompting laughter from the crowd. “But seriously, you know the truth.”
Wonder then shared the reality: “The truth is that I lost my sight shortly after I was born. It was a blessing, it allowed me to see the world with a vision of truth. To see people for their spirit, not for how they look. Not for the color of their skin, but for the color of their soul.”
